Notes
1
As an Energy Star Partner, Weil-McLain
has determined that
Evergreen
® 220
and 299 boilers meet the Energy Star
guidelines for energy efficiency.
NOTE: Adjusting boiler firing rate will
affect AFUE rating.
2
Based on standard test procedures
prescribed by the United States Depart-
ment of Energy. Ratings also referred to
as CSA Output.
NOTE that only DOE Heating Capacity
and AFUE are certified by AHRI. AFUE
is also know as Annual Fuel Utilization
Efficiency or Seasonal Efficiency.
3
Net AHRI ratings are based on net
installed radiation of sufficient quantity
for requirements of the building and
nothing need be added for normal
piping and pickup. Ratings are based
on a piping and pickup allowance of
1.15. An additional allowance should
be made for unusual piping and pickup
loads.
4
Evergreen
®
boilers must be direct-vented.
Evergreen
®
boilers require special vent-
ing, consistent with Category IV boiler.
Use only the vent materials and meth-
ods specified in this manual.
Evergreen
®
220 vent/air pipes can be
either 3” or 4”.
Evergreen
®
299/300/399
vent/air pipes must be 4”.
All vent and air pipe elbows must
be sweep elbows, NOT short-radius
elbows.
5
Ratings shown are for sea level ap-
plications only. For altitudes from sea
level to 2000 feet above sea level, the
Evergreen
®
boiler requires no modifica-
tions. The boiler automatically derates
itself by approximately 4% per 1000 feet
above sea level.
6
All of the boilers will automatically
de-rate as vent/air pipe length increases,
due to the pressure loss through the
piping. For vent/air pipe lengths less
than the maximum, the derate equals
the value above times vent length ÷ 100.
THE
OUTDOOR SENSOR
SUPPLIED WITH THE BOILER MUST BE INSTALLED UNLESS EXEMPTED BELOW:
IMPORTANT
In accordance with
Section 303 of the
2007 Energy Act
, this boiler is equipped
with a feature that saves energy by reducing
the boiler water temperature as the heating
load decreases. This feature is equipped with
an override which is provided primarily to
permit the use of an external energy manage-
ment system that serves the same function.
THIS OVERRIDE MUST NOT BE USED UNLESS AT LEAST ONE OF THE FOLLOWING
CONDITIONS IS TRUE:
• An external energy management system is installed that reduces the boiler water temperature as the
heating load decreases.
• This boiler is not used for any space heating.
• This boiler is part of a modular or multiple boiler system having a total input of 300,000 BTU/hr or
greater.
• This boiler is equipped with a tankless coil (not applicable to
Evergreen
®
).
